The 4 official ways to download Windows 11
All four methods pull the same Windows 11 24H2 files from Microsoft. The right choice depends on whether you are upgrading the PC you are on now, building install media for other machines, or doing a clean install.
| Method | Best for | Output | Link |
|---|---|---|---|
| Installation Assistant | Upgrading the PC you are using now, in place, keeping files and apps | Runs the upgrade directly | Microsoft ↗ |
| Media Creation Tool | Making a bootable USB or an ISO to install on one or more PCs | Bootable USB or ISO file | Microsoft ↗ |
| Direct ISO download | A clean install, virtual machines, or your own USB tool (Rufus) | .iso file (~6 GB) | Microsoft ↗ |
| Windows Update | Eligible Windows 10 PCs — the simplest, no download tool needed | In-place upgrade offer | Settings > Windows Update |
On Microsoft's Download Windows 11 page, the Installation Assistant, Media Creation Tool, and ISO all appear as separate sections. The fourth path, Windows Update, needs no download tool at all.
Windows 11 Installation Assistant
The Windows 11 Installation Assistant upgrades the PC you are currently running from Windows 10 to Windows 11 without touching your files or installed apps. It is the fastest route when your existing PC meets the requirements and you simply want to move up to Windows 11.
Use it when: you are on a compatible Windows 10 PC, you want an in-place upgrade, and you do not need install media for other machines.
- Open the Download Windows 11 page and download the Installation Assistant.
- Run the downloaded file and accept the license terms.
- The tool checks compatibility, downloads Windows 11, and prepares the upgrade.
- Restart when prompted. Your files, settings, and apps carry over.
Windows 11 Media Creation Tool
The Windows 11 Media Creation Tool downloads the install files and either writes them straight to a USB drive or saves them as an ISO. This is the method to use when you need to install Windows 11 on more than one PC, or on a different PC from the one you are downloading on.
You need an 8 GB or larger USB drive (its contents are erased) or space for a ~6 GB ISO file.
- Download the Media Creation Tool from the Download Windows 11 page.
- Run it and accept the license terms.
- Confirm the language and edition, or accept the recommended options for the current PC.
- Choose USB flash drive to write a bootable drive directly, or ISO file to save an image you can use later.
- Wait for the download and write to finish, then boot the target PC from the USB to install.
Direct ISO download
The direct ISO download gives you just the Windows 11 disc image (.iso). It is the most flexible option for a clean install, for virtual machines, or when you prefer your own USB tool such as Rufus. Microsoft's ISO download links are signed and expire after 24 hours, so download the file shortly before you plan to use it.

System requirements
Before you download, confirm the PC can run Windows 11. Microsoft's free PC Health Check app gives a clear pass or fail and names the specific requirement a PC misses.
| Requirement | Minimum for Windows 11 24H2 |
|---|---|
| Processor | 1 GHz or faster, 2 or more cores, 64-bit, on Microsoft's approved CPU list |
| RAM | 4 GB |
| Storage | 64 GB or larger |
| TPM | TPM 2.0 |
| Firmware | UEFI with Secure Boot capable |
| Graphics | DirectX 12 compatible, WDDM 2.0 driver |
| Display | 720p, larger than 9 inches diagonal, 8 bits per color channel |
The two requirements that most often block older hardware are TPM 2.0 and Secure Boot. Both are frequently present but disabled in the firmware — look for fTPM or PTT and a Secure Boot option in the BIOS or UEFI setup.

Download Windows 11 free (without a product key)
The Windows 11 download itself is free from Microsoft, and you can install it without entering a product key. At the activation screen during setup, select I don't have a product key. Windows 11 installs and runs fully, with two minor limits until you activate: an "Activate Windows" watermark on the desktop, and some personalization settings (such as changing the accent color and wallpaper) stay locked. Security updates still install normally.
This applies to both Windows 11 Home and Windows 11 Pro — you can download and install either edition free, then activate later. To activate, you need a valid product key. After installing — activate and set up
Once Windows 11 is running, activate it under Settings > System > Activation, then bring the PC up to date through Windows Update and install your applications.
FAQ
Is Windows 11 free to download?
Yes. Microsoft provides the Windows 11 download free through the Installation Assistant, Media Creation Tool, and direct ISO. Eligible Windows 10 PCs can also upgrade free through Windows Update. A product key is only needed to activate Windows after install.
How big is the Windows 11 download?
The Windows 11 24H2 ISO is roughly 5 to 6 GB. The Installation Assistant and Media Creation Tool download a similar volume of data. Allow extra free disk space during the upgrade or clean install.
Can my PC run Windows 11?
It can if it meets the minimum requirements: a supported 64-bit CPU with 2 or more cores, 4 GB RAM, 64 GB storage, TPM 2.0, and UEFI with Secure Boot. Run Microsoft's free PC Health Check app to get a definitive pass or fail and see which requirement, if any, is missing.
